I can still hear a few Volz-styled songs on albums after BTTS. I can well imagine him singing "Keneniah" and "The Water is Alive". To me, "Keneniah" is a typical "classic Petra" song with story-telling lyrics, such as "Let everything that hath Breath" had. In my mind I can hear that song with JDB production and Volz singing, on MPTY or NOTW. In my mind I can also hear Volz on "Mine Field", as the pace, rhythm and keyboard solo sounds like it could have come of BTS. Turning things around a bit, I can also hear Schlitt and the Dream Team playing, with Elefante production, "Without You I would surely die", even though that song was written by Hough and not Hartman. The overall energetic rock style of that song reminds me of "All Fired Up".
